Output 2295249a95961fc7b3173cb85c863e92d1633a1e8b440cc7a4d0ad88707b08e3:1

value
149095966
script pubkey
OP_0 OP_PUSHBYTES_20 1924120a7bb63fb56e43e4aef30f4e9e56cbc5c0
address
ltc1qryjpyznmkclm2mjrujh0xr6wnetvh3wqrv26ww
transaction
2295249a95961fc7b3173cb85c863e92d1633a1e8b440cc7a4d0ad88707b08e3
spent
true